West San Jose Home Sale and Listing Trends from January, 2003 through January, 2012

Graph of West San Jose Home Sale and Listing Trends January 2003 through 2012

The Graph shows the number of Single Family Residence Listings (i.e., homes put on the MLS Market For Sale) and Sales according to the local Multiple Listing Service (MLS;MLSListings, Inc.). I've included zip codes: 95117, 95129, 95130 and a slice of 95128. A map showing each West San Jose home sale in January 2012 is shown here.

Over the past 10 Januaries, West San Jose home Sales and Listings have been, shall we say, all over the place? And that makes sense; there have been no consistent, sustained trends over the past 10 years in West San Jose or any other part of California, or the U.S., I think.

From 2003 to 2008, West San Jose Home Sales were trending downward. Since 2008 they were trending upward until this past January, when sales dropped to a near 10-year low.

Listings have also been all over the place. But most recently, since 2010, they've been trending upward. Still, 46 Listings in West San Jose is slightly less than the 10-year average of 49.

West San Jose families send their children to one of three school districts: The Cupertino Union School District; the Moreland Union School District or the Campbell Unified School District. Of the three, the Cupertino Union SD has the highest average API achievement test scores and is therefore the most sought-after by many of today's young, children-oriented, home buyers.

Home located in the Cupertino School District portion of West San Jose sell quickly and for top dollar. It's almost always a Seller's Market in the Cupertino School District. Homes in either the Moreland Union or Campbell Unified School Districts are in a more balanced market. Sellers must have their homes properly positioned and marketed; buyers can afford to take their time shopping for the best home. I should add that Country Lane Elementary School in the Moreland School District, plus other Moreland schools, are as sought-after as some Elementary Schools in the Cupertino School District.

West San Jose Home Sales in January, 2012.

The Map and Table show all West San Jose homes sold in January, 2012 according to the local Multiple Listing Service (MLS; MLSListings, Inc.). Zip codes include 95117, 95129, 95130 and a portion of 95128.

Three different Elementary School Districts (shown in the right column of the Table below), educate the children of West San Jose: The Cupertino Union Elementary School District (west of Lawrence Expressway plus a small slice east of Lawrence Expressway; Moreland Elementary School District and Campbell Unified. The Cupertino School District has the highest API test scores and is therefore the most popular. Four of the five homes located in that school district sold for more than their Asking Price.

The bottom row of the Chart shows the averages. The "average" home sold in West San Jose in January, 2012 was a 3.3 bedroom, 2.1 bathroom home with 1,603 square feet on a 8,277 sq. ft. lot. It was 54 years old and on the Market (DOM) for 53 days before an offer was accepted. The average List (Asking) Price was $763,885 and the average Sale Price was $772,667, or 101% of the List Price. Competing home buyers bid prices up, particularly in the Cupertino School District.
